Overview

The PreSonus StudioLive 16.0.2 USB Recording Mixer Bundle is designed to give musicians, podcasters, and small venue operators a complete signal chain out of the box. At its center is the StudioLive 16.0.2, a 16-channel digital mixer featuring 12 Class A XMAX solid-state microphone preamps known for their clean gain and low noise floor. The mixer provides 8 mono and 4 stereo input channels with 60mm faders, 4 auxiliary buses, 2 internal 32-bit effects processors, and Fat Channel processing — including 3-band semi-parametric EQ, compressor, downward expander, and limiter — on every channel and bus. A stereo 31-band graphic EQ on the main bus gives you final mix-shaping control for both live and studio applications.

Beyond its mixing capabilities, the StudioLive 16.0.2 doubles as an 18-in/16-out USB 2.0 audio interface, allowing full multitrack recording at 24-bit resolution up to 48kHz. The included PreSonus Studio One Artist DAW and Capture live-recording software mean you can begin recording immediately without sourcing additional software. The bundle rounds out the signal chain with an Audio-Technica AT2020 cardioid condenser microphone — a widely respected studio workhorse with a custom low-mass diaphragm for extended frequency response — plus Rockville PRO-M50 studio headphones with a detachable coil cable and carrying case, and five 20-foot XLR cables to connect everything. Pros & Cons

👍 Pros

  • All-in-one bundle eliminates the guesswork of buying a mixer, microphone, headphones, and cables separately.
  • 18-in/16-out USB interface allows multitrack recording of every channel directly to a computer.
  • 12 Class A XMAX preamps deliver clean, low-noise gain suitable for professional recording and live sound.
  • Built-in Fat Channel processing with EQ, compressor, expander, and limiter on every channel reduces the need for outboard gear.
  • Included Studio One Artist DAW and Capture software provide a complete recording workflow without additional software purchases.

👎 Cons

  • USB 2.0 interface is limited to 24-bit/48kHz and lacks the bandwidth for higher sample rates.
  • At 20 pounds and over 15 inches wide, the mixer is bulky for portable or travel recording setups.
  • The bundled Rockville headphones and cables are entry-level and may need upgrading for critical listening.
  • No USB 3.0 or Thunderbolt connectivity, which limits future-proofing as audio interfaces move to faster standards.
  • Scene recall and MIDI control add complexity that may overwhelm users who only need basic mixing and recording.
